The way of the future in Afghanistan

On 12 Jan in Afghanistan there was a protest against the government during which things got violent and the local school was burned down in the village of Garmsir. US Marines were present but did not interfere at all, as no lives were threatened. Last week about 800 local residents gathered to discuss what had happened. One major concern was that a Quran had been desecrated–indeed, about 300 copies had burned with the school.br /br /The local governor pointed out that the demonstration was not like the local population. He pointed out that it was the Taliban, the local terrorists, who stired people up. The loss of the school, the place the future citizens were being educated to help bring a better future to the area, plus the distrust among the local people was their goal.br /br /All agreed that they must work together. They also thanked the Marines for being respectful during the disturbance. This is the way of the future for this area–recognizing who the enemy really is.
